What affects the price

Replacing your roof involves several variables that shift your final bill. The total square footage of your property is the biggest factor, followed closely by the pitch or steepness of your roof, which dictates how safely crews can work. You will also need to choose your materials—architectural shingles, metal, or tile each carry different price points. We also have to account for the removal and disposal of your current roof, plus the condition of the underlying wood decking that might need repairs once the old shingles are off. What is TPO roofing and is it suitable for homes in Chico?

TPO (Thermoplastic Olefin) roofing is a single-ply reflective roofing membrane made from polypropylene and ethylene-propylene rubber. It's commonly used on flat or low-slope roofs, often seen on commercial buildings but also suitable for certain residential applications in Chico. TPO is known for its durability, energy efficiency due to its reflective surface, and resistance to punctures and tears. Discussing its suitability with a local roofing specialist is advised.

What are corrugated metal roofing panels?

Corrugated metal roofing panels are metal sheets formed with a series of parallel ridges and grooves, creating a wavy pattern. This corrugated design adds strength and rigidity to the panels, making them durable and weather-resistant. They are a popular choice for both residential and agricultural buildings due to their longevity and relatively easy installation. In Chico, these panels offer a robust solution against wind and rain. They come in various materials like steel, aluminum, and zinc, and are available in different finishes and colors.

When is roofing tar used in roofing projects?

Roofing tar, also known as asphalt-based sealant, is primarily used for sealing seams and small cracks in roofing systems, especially on flat or low-slope roofs. It's also sometimes used as an underlayment adhesive. In Chico, it can be applied to seal joints in asphalt shingles or around flashing to prevent water penetration. While effective for certain applications, it's important to use the right type of tar and apply it correctly.
